Output 30d1695595ea11bcc604ab7b54fb06a06033864daf65320c573c10ad88540f66:1

value
345380908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d94689306c241450c1dce595f87e46bbb8484bd OP_EQUAL
address
MGRxrsc67aRT5DHujQwa2wXz8rQvFQnHmq
transaction
30d1695595ea11bcc604ab7b54fb06a06033864daf65320c573c10ad88540f66
spent
true